Abstract

This study aimed to describe the level of dynamic capability models in Village Unit Cooperatives in all Village Unit Cooperatives consisting of ten districts/cities in the districts of Kediri and Madiun, East Java Province. Data collection through direct observation and surveys. The measurement uses seven Likert scales as a basis for describing dynamic capability characteristics. The results showed a dynamic capability models in Village Unit Cooperatives are still not optimal. A measurement model on specific dynamic capabilities (acquiring, developing, creating, and combining knowledge) in Village Unit Cooperatives. Managers with regard to dynamic capabilities are the right choice to understand the fast changing business environment. The limitations of this study are only two of the seven residencies in the province of East Java, Indonesia. Keywords: dynamic capabilities, village unit cooperatives
